// Pagination on the Plumely public REST API is cursor-based —
// grab `next_cursor` from each response and pass it back as `cursor`.
// Don't cache cursors across sessions; they expire after ~10 minutes.
// Page size maxes out at 200, so don't bother asking for more.
// The client below talks to our internal gateway, which wants the
// service key that follows on the next line.

API key for tagef-fafop: vxb2-ta

## Step 4: Update Planner Configuration

After upgrading the Snackline restock planner to version 3, the old `routes.ini` file is ignored. The planner now reads a single YAML config that covers depot schedules, truck capacity, and stockout thresholds. Copy the template from the deploy folder, adjust the depot names for your region, and remove the legacy file to avoid confusion. For a standard regional install, the configuration should look like this.

service settings:
[casax]
port = 6379
team = rusir
host = casax.zemvarhq.corp
region = outer-4
access_code = ac_9808ce
timeout_ms = 1500

To the release manager: I'm passing ownership of the Pellwick deep-link router to Sorrel before the 4.2 cut. The intent-matching table now lives in the Farrowgate config service; stale entries were purged last sprint. Watch the fallback route — it silently swallows malformed slugs, which inflated our drop-off metrics in March. The staging resolver needs its keystore unlocked before each regression pass, and that keystore accepts only one credential. For the signing vault, the recovery phrase is noted directly below.

recovery phrase for tafog-fafog: novix-novdor-fraath-brieth-olieth-oliix-rusix-wenion-julax-druox

## Deploying the Gatewick Proctor Queue

Deploys are pretty painless: push to main, wait for the pipeline, then watch the queue drain dashboard for five minutes. If candidates pile up mid-exam, roll back first and ask questions later — the queue replays safely. Everything the workers care about lives in one config block, shown here for reference.

settings of bafof-yagef:
JOROX_PIN=8740
JOROX_TENANT=pelox
JOROX_METRICS_HOST=metrics.jorox.qorvelworks.internal
JOROX_SEAL=seal_c78f63c1
JOROX_STANDBY_TEAM=norax